Land in Ukraine is at the center of numerous contentious issues, from corruption and illegal appropriation to reforms and war implications. In a recent scandal, Zhytomyr farmers are accused of cultivating radiated land. Simultaneously, a former head of StateGeoCadastre faces extradition for allegedly misappropriating land worth over UAH 1.8 billion. Land corruption persists with revelations such as a state enterprise director accepting bribes for construction zoning, and illicit land distribution by Russian occupiers in Zaporizhzhia. To address these issues, President Zelenskyy enacted Draft Law No. 12089 aimed at protecting bona fide land purchasers, while the NABU tirelessly uncovers deceit and fraud to restore lawful land distribution in Ukraine.

What is causing land issues in Ukraine currently?

Land issues in Ukraine include corrupt land deals, exploitation of radioactive soil, and the illegal appropriation of land by both local authorities and foreign occupants. These activities have plagued Ukraine, prompting actions from law enforcement and policy changes to curb corruption.

What recent legal action has been taken against land corruption in Ukraine?

The Ukrainian NABU and SAPO have been active in fighting land corruption, notably in a recent operation named "Clean City," which targeted a criminal network misappropriating land and public funds. Additionally, criminal charges have been laid against various individuals involved in corrupt land deals.

What laws has Ukraine enacted to address land misappropriation?

President Zelenskyy signed draft law No. 12089 to strengthen protections for good faith purchasers of land. This law aims to solidify legal ownership and curtail illegal land seizures, ensuring that land reforms benefit legitimate stakeholders and curb fraudulent activities.

How is radioactive soil being dealt with in Ukrainian agriculture?

Radioactive soil issues have been exposed in cities like Zhytomyr, where land was used for cultivation despite contamination risks. Polish authorities have uncovered related criminal acts, leading to investigations and potential prosecutions to prevent such hazardous agricultural practices.

What is the significance of the land reform laws recently passed in Ukraine?

The recent land reform laws, including the abolishment of the land sale moratorium, are pivotal in transforming Ukraine’s agricultural sector. These reforms aim to create a transparent and functional land market, allowing for improved economic growth and development by legalizing and regulating land sales.

How do Ukrainian reforms aim to protect bona fide land buyers?

The newly signed draft law protects bona fide land buyers by legitimizing transactions and preventing fraud through enforcing stricter regulations and providing legal avenues to contest illegal land appropriations, thus securing investments and ensuring rightful ownership.

What actions have been taken against the misuse of land during the ongoing conflict in Ukraine?

The Ukrainian government has condemned and opposed the illegal land distribution by Russian occupiers in areas like Zaporizhzhia, where land is used to entice participation in the conflict. Efforts are continuously being made to reclaim these lands and prosecute offenders to restore sovereignty and law.
